(110 days) F-1 hybrid. Named for a prefecture on Honshu Island in Japan known for its cabbage production. Our choice for a superior flat-topped green cabbage ideal for cooks and gourmets, great for kraut and kimchi. Good moisture content makes sufficient brine so that you don’t need to add more to the kraut. Sweet tender wrapper leaves suitable for using raw for cabbage wraps and rolls.
Its large heads (avg. 5–7 lb but can get up to 11–13 lb) remain almost coreless. Although ready on Aug. 2 from a May 21 transplanting, they sat in the field for two months without splitting. Outer leaves can’t hold up once temperatures plummet to the 20s, so not for storage. Resists FY, TB. Tested negative for BR and BL.
